Fiercely protective of an unrivalled reputation in the freezing, storage and distribution of such goods, The Ice Co° Logistics and Storage can trace the origins of its company back to 1860. Now based across five sites in the UK, this logistics division of Europeâs largest ice manufacturer offers bespoke temperature controlled storage and distribution services.
Because of further capital investments required within The Ice Co business group the preferred option was to lease new trucks and trailers which led them to the door of Total Reefer, part of the Asset Alliance Group of companies.
Steve Barker, Total Reefer MD, explained: âDue to the complexity of the recent tender, The Ice Co asked Total Reefer if they could help. Weâve had a good working relationship with them over recent years and therefore the short answer was âYesâ we could.â
Calling on the resources and back up of the ATE Trailers side of the business, Steve came up with an acceptable solution to help secure the deal; âWe couldnât take all trailers on to our books, so we devised a three part strategy whereby some were sold directly through ATE, another proportion were agreed on a sale and lease-back deal, leaving The Ice Co to run and look after the remainder. We then sourced ten new trailers from Schmitz-Cargobull, built to The Ice Coâs specification, complete with preferred ThermoKing refrigeration units, which have now been delivered on a full five year contract deal.â
A further transaction resulted in the supply of ten new Mercedes-Benz Actros tractor units: âThe customer already had a good relationship with their local dealer, Northside Truck & Van, and following test drives with other manufacturers, the customer chose to stick with Northside and the deal was done, part of which includes driver training on the new vehicles when they are delivered to ensure maximum fuel efficiency is attained.â
